Exam Pattern :
Computer Based Test (CBT) Exam Pattern
| Subject/Section | No. of Questions | Marks | Duration |
|---|---|---|---|
| General Intelligence & Reasoning | 50 | 50 | 30 minutes |
| General Awareness | 50 | 50 | 30 minutes |
| English Language & Comprehension | 100 | 100 | 60 minutes |
| Total | 200 | 200 | 120 minutes |
Important Points:
- Each correct answer carries 1 mark
- Negative marking:Â 0.25Â marks deducted for each wrong answer
- No marks will be awarded for unattempted questions
- Sectional timing is applicable
- Question paper is bilingual (English & Hindi) except English section
Skill Test (Stenography Test) – Qualifying Nature
- Grade C:Â 100 words per minute (wpm)
- Grade D:Â 80 words per minute (wpm)
Dictation followed by Transcription on Computer.

Subject Wise Syllabus :
1. General Intelligence & Reasoning
- Analogies, Similarities and Differences
- Space Visualization, Problem Solving, Analysis
- Judgment, Decision Making, Visual Memory
- Discriminating Observation, Relationship Concepts
- Arithmetical Reasoning, Number Series
- Verbal & Figure Classification, Coding-Decoding
- Blood Relations, Direction Sense, Puzzles
- Non-Verbal Reasoning (Mirror/Water Images, Paper Folding)
2. General Awareness
- Current Affairs (National & International)
- Indian History, Geography, Polity & Constitution
- Indian Economy, Science & Technology
- Static GK: Awards, Books, Authors, Sports
- Important Schemes, Government Policies
- Environmental Issues, International Organizations
3. English Language & Comprehension
- Reading Comprehension
- Grammar (Tenses, Articles, Prepositions)
- Vocabulary (Synonyms, Antonyms, One Word Substitution)
- Error Spotting, Sentence Improvement
- Cloze Test, Para Jumbles, Fill in the Blanks
- Idioms & Phrases, Spellings
- Active & Passive Voice, Direct & Indirect Speech
